Hi!
	just for sake of exploring, I've begun to develop a program in GTK+ 2.0. 
Now, I'd like to get it packaged properly, so I really need all the 
automake/autoconf stuff... in the other programs I made, it was easy to 
find another similar program, just... eeeh... "quote" ;) that kind of 
stuff from there, and then modify the scripts for my own purposes. The 
matter is, I don't know of any simple program that uses GTK2, for now. 
Could you address me, please? Or just advice me to a good documentation 
that can explain how to make myself such scripts, and/or which 
differences are there (if any) with the GTK-1.2-style ones?
	Thanks in advance, and compliments for the really good work you're doing 
with GTK2,
		Mano :)
PS: I'd like something less complex than GIMP 1.3.x...
